Upgrading Graylog from 5.0.6 to 5.1.3

Hi,

I run Graylog Open V5.0.6 on AlmaLinux 8.8.

Under System > Overview, Graylog reminds me that I run an outdated Graylog version


You are running an outdated Graylog version. (triggered 6 days ago)

The most recent stable Graylog version is 5.1.3 (Noir) released at 2023-07-05T00:00:00.000Z.

I tried to upgrade Graylog accordingly to documentation
https://go2docs.graylog.org/5-0/upgrading_graylog/upgrading_graylog_in_red_hat.htm

but yum offers only the version 5.0.6

yum list graylog-server --showduplicates

Last metadata expiration check: 0:02:51 ago on Mon 24 Jul 2023 09:11:47 AM CEST.
Installed Packages
graylog-server.x86_64 5.0.6-1
